引言
随着大数据时代的到来,数据挖掘建模已成为企业决策和科研创新的重要手段。本文将深入探讨数据挖掘建模的实战技巧,并通过案例分析,帮助读者更好地理解和应用这一领域。
一、数据挖掘建模概述
1.1 数据挖掘建模的定义
数据挖掘建模是指利用统计学、机器学习、数据库挖掘等技术,从大量数据中提取有价值的信息,为决策提供支持的过程。
1.2 数据挖掘建模的应用领域
数据挖掘建模广泛应用于金融、医疗、电商、物联网等多个领域,如客户细分、风险控制、推荐系统等。
二、数据挖掘建模的实战技巧
2.1 数据预处理
- 数据清洗:去除重复、错误、缺失的数据。
- 数据集成:将不同来源、格式的数据进行整合。
- 数据转换:将数据转换为适合建模的格式,如归一化、标准化等。
2.2 模型选择
- 根据业务需求选择合适的模型,如线性回归、决策树、支持向量机等。
- 考虑模型的复杂度、可解释性、泛化能力等因素。
2.3 模型训练与调优
- 划分训练集和测试集,使用训练集对模型进行训练。
- 使用交叉验证等方法评估模型性能。
- 调整模型参数,优化模型性能。
2.4 模型评估与部署
- 使用测试集评估模型性能,如准确率、召回率、F1值等。
- 将模型部署到实际业务场景中,进行实时预测。
三、案例分析
3.1 案例一:电商推荐系统
3.1.1 业务背景
某电商平台希望通过推荐系统提高用户购买转化率。
3.1.2 数据预处理
- 数据清洗:去除重复、错误、缺失的用户购买记录。
- 数据集成:整合用户行为数据、商品信息等。
3.1.3 模型选择与训练
- 选择协同过滤算法作为推荐模型。
- 使用用户行为数据进行模型训练。
3.1.4 模型评估与部署
- 使用A/B测试评估推荐效果。
- 将模型部署到实际业务场景中。
3.2 案例二:金融风控
3.2.1 业务背景
某金融机构希望通过风控模型降低贷款违约率。
3.2.2 数据预处理
- 数据清洗:去除重复、错误、缺失的贷款数据。
- 数据集成:整合借款人信息、贷款信息等。
3.2.3 模型选择与训练
- 选择逻辑回归模型作为风控模型。
- 使用贷款数据对模型进行训练。
3.2.4 模型评估与部署
- 使用混淆矩阵评估模型性能。
- 将模型部署到实际业务场景中。
四、总结
数据挖掘建模在各个领域都有广泛的应用,掌握实战技巧和案例分析对于提升建模能力至关重要。本文通过介绍数据挖掘建模的实战技巧和案例分析,希望能帮助读者更好地理解和应用这一领域。